eLearning design brief template

Use this practical eLearning design brief template to agree the business need, audience, outcomes, scope, assessment, stakeholders and delivery constraints before authoring starts.

1. Business need

What problem are we trying to solve?

  • What is happening now?
  • What should people do differently?
  • What evidence shows this is a learning problem rather than a process, system or management problem?
  • What happens if nothing changes?

2. Audience

  • Who are the learners?
  • What do they already know?
  • What devices and working environments will they use?
  • Are there accessibility, language or confidence considerations?

3. Learning outcomes

Write a small number of measurable outcomes beginning with what the learner will be able to do. Avoid outcomes such as “understand” unless you can define the evidence that proves understanding.

4. Scope and content

  • Must-know content
  • Useful reference content
  • Out-of-scope material
  • Policies, systems or source documents
  • Required scenarios, examples or demonstrations

5. Practice and assessment

  • What should learners practise?
  • What evidence will demonstrate competence?
  • Is there a pass mark?
  • How many attempts are allowed?
  • What feedback should learners receive?

6. Delivery and technical requirements

  • Target LMS
  • SCORM or other export requirement
  • Expected course duration
  • Mobile or desktop priorities
  • Branding and accessibility requirements

7. Stakeholders and review

  • Project owner
  • Subject-matter expert
  • Approver
  • Technical/LMS contact
  • Review rounds and final sign-off date

Agree who can approve content before development begins. Otherwise feedback can expand indefinitely.
